diff --git a/src/options_pprof_test.go b/src/options_pprof_test.go new file mode 100644 index 00000000..ad47d1f4 --- /dev/null +++ b/src/options_pprof_test.go @@ -0,0 +1,89 @@ +//go:build pprof +// +build pprof + +package fzf + +import ( + "bytes" + "flag" + "os" + "os/exec" + "path/filepath" + "testing" + + "github.com/junegunn/fzf/src/util" +) + +// runInitProfileTests is an internal flag used TestInitProfiling +var runInitProfileTests = flag.Bool("test-init-profile", false, "run init profile tests") + +func TestInitProfiling(t *testing.T) { + if testing.Short() { + t.Skip("short test") + } + + // Run this test in a separate process since it interferes with + // profiling and modifies the global atexit state. Without this + // running `go test -bench . -cpuprofile cpu.out` will fail. + if !*runInitProfileTests { + t.Parallel() + + // Make sure we are not the child process. + if os.Getenv("_FZF_CHILD_PROC") != "" { + t.Fatal("already running as child process!") + } + + cmd := exec.Command(os.Args[0], + "-test.timeout", "30s", + "-test.run", "^"+t.Name()+"$", + "-test-init-profile", + ) + cmd.Env = append(os.Environ(), "_FZF_CHILD_PROC=1") + + out, err := cmd.CombinedOutput() + out = bytes.TrimSpace(out) + if err != nil { + t.Fatalf("Child test process failed: %v:\n%s", err, out) + } + // Make sure the test actually ran + if bytes.Contains(out, []byte("no tests to run")) { + t.Fatalf("Failed to run test %q:\n%s", t.Name(), out) + } + return + } + + // Child process + + tempdir := t.TempDir() + t.Cleanup(util.RunAtExitFuncs) + + o := Options{ + CPUProfile: filepath.Join(tempdir, "cpu.prof"), + MEMProfile: filepath.Join(tempdir, "mem.prof"), + BlockProfile: filepath.Join(tempdir, "block.prof"), + MutexProfile: filepath.Join(tempdir, "mutex.prof"), + } + if err := o.initProfiling(); err != nil { + t.Fatal(err) + } + + profiles := []string{ + o.CPUProfile, + o.MEMProfile, + o.BlockProfile, + o.MutexProfile, + } + for _, name := range profiles { + if _, err := os.Stat(name); err != nil { + t.Errorf("Failed to create profile %s: %v", filepath.Base(name), err) + } + } + + util.RunAtExitFuncs() + + for _, name := range profiles { + if _, err := os.Stat(name); err != nil { + t.Errorf("Failed to write profile %s: %v", filepath.Base(name), err) + } + } +} |
